Monitor Audio has been showing off its new range of Shadow wall-mounted speakers at CES.
monitor_audio_shadow Monitor Audio Shadow series
The series consists of three speaker models and a centre channel. The smallest is the Shadow 25, intended as a satellite or rear channel speaker, which uses a 4in Flat RDR mid/bass driver and a 25cm dome tweeter.
It has 84dB sensitivity rating, a max power handling of 60 watts, and like the other Shadows, it’s designed with wall-mounting in mind, but also comes with a metal desktop stand.
Then there’s the Shadow 50, which has two 4in RDT drivers, a 25mm C-CAM tweeter and two flat ABR drivers. It’s intended for use with TV screens up to 50in in size and has a sensitivity rating of 87dB and a max power handling of 120 watts.
The largest is the Shadow 60 which has the same drivers but in a larger cabinet, and is intended for bigger screen sizes.
The Shadow centre speaker also uses the same speakers as the 50 and 60, but in a sideways configuration.
Among Monitor Audio’s innovations for the Shadow series are the high power Neo magnet system in the 4in mid/bass drivers – strong than you would usually expect but necessary to achieve the slimline profile.
Also helping to keep the speakers thin is a floating driver and a special ‘concertina’ driver suspension arrangement, as well as a new proprietary tweeter and the one-piece aluminium extruded cabinets.
